machinable glass-ceramic possesses a singular microstructure, made up of modest, interlocked plate-like mica crystals dispersed within the mum or dad glass matrix. These randomly oriented crystals are important to your machinability of MACOR®. The MACOR® machining procedure is compared with that found in metals and plastics the place plastic deformation takes place just before chip development. Material elimination in MACOR® is by means of a managed fracture process. Like normal mica, it is actually tough to propagate a crack from the crystal sheets in MACOR® Even though the individual sheets is often divided very easily alongside their cleavage planes.

MACOR® possesses a variety of noteworthy physical Qualities. It's a ongoing use temperature of 800°C. Its coefficient of thermal enlargement easily matches most metals and sealing glasses.

MACOR® is melted and cast using regular glass making strategies. This is a fluorine wealthy glass by using a composition approaching trisilicic fluorphlogopite mica (KMg3AlSi3O10F2). Upon cooling through the soften, the glass spontaneously section separates into fluorine wealthy droplets. The resulting glass has the appearance of an opal glass. Subsequent managed heat treatment devitrifies the fluorine prosperous droplets causing a series of morphological changes eventually causing the formation of randomly oriented, interlocked, sheet-like fluorphlogopite mica crystals in the alumino-borosilicate glass matrix.
